Security

UPVC doors can come with a variety of security features to help secure your home. These options are cost-effective, simple to install, and inexpensive. However, they do not guarantee 100% security.

Burglars always find ways to gain access. The most popular strategy used by burglars is to break the lock. If you have an anti-snap lock, you stand a better chance of preventing this kind of break-in.

Another option is to break into with the help of a heavy object. This is difficult to prevent. You won't be able to safeguard your home from this risk unless you have a monitored alarm system.

It is an excellent idea to put security bars on your patio door in order to secure it from burglars. You can put them in place before you go to bed and also before you leave. In the evening, doors are especially vulnerable.

Hinge bolts are an additional measure to consider. A hinge bolt is a great idea, particularly if the door has an opening to the outside.

Door chains can also be useful to secure replacing upvc door locks doors. They are not strong enough to withstand all force kicks or ramming attacks.

Shatterproof films can be put on glass panels. There are many types of shatterproof films that are available. You can choose the one that best suits your requirements best. Some are translucent, while others are tinted.

Security cameras can be used to spot burglars in the act. You can also install a motion-activated light that doesn't require wiring. In addition, you could install security lighting to deter burglars.

While no security measure is 100% foolproof however, you can greatly reduce your risks by taking the necessary steps to protect your home.
